Facilities Ticket — Cleaning Crew Access, Brindle Annex

For new starters handling evening lock-up: the Sorano Cleaning crew arrives nightly at 21:30 via the annex side door. Check their rota sheet, note arrival in the log, and ensure the storeroom is relocked afterward. To let them through the side door, enter the access code below.

badge for yaweg-hafog: bdg-GX-6

**Checklist item: DeployBot status responder**

Confirm the Harrowgate chat bot answers `status` queries in the release room with the current stage, rollout percentage, and last gate passed. Verify it distinguishes canary from full rollout and refuses status requests for unreleased environments. Once responses match the dashboard for three consecutive polls, mark this item done and attach the build identifier shown below.

session token of fahap-hawip = htk31_7852f2b3276dba2738f98fa97f92237

- [ ] Step 7: Archive cold storage buckets (Glacierline tier). Confirm both ceremony witnesses are present, verify bucket manifests match the Oxbow ledger, then seal the archive key shares. Plugin authors may observe but not handle shares. Once sealed, the archive index itself is encrypted and can only be reopened with the passphrase below.

vault phrase of badup-hahig = tamael-aldael-kelmir-istael-fenok-istwyn-tamius-jorath-oliion

**ENG-4471 — CSV import wizard: signature check failing**

For weekly sync: the Fieldnote CSV import wizard rejects all template bundles since Thursday. Verifier reports bad signature on every upload, even known-good fixtures. Root cause: bundle signer rotated but the wizard's embedded trust anchor wasn't updated. Fix is a one-line config change plus redeploy; ETA Friday. Until then imports are blocked. Updated bundles must verify against the key below.

signing key of bagap-yawep = bky13_TbfT6ZMUoGJo2